Mission

The Community Foundation for Northeast Georgia seeks to enhance the quality of life of the citizens of Northeast Georgia and the generations that will follow. It fulfills this mission through the philanthropic support of activities in education, health, human service, community service and the arts. The Foundation strives to assess community needs, especially as they impact the less fortunate, and to attract funding to meet those needs. It serves as a catalyst for constructive programs and initiatives that serve the citizens of our region. The Foundation acts as a responsible steward for the funds entrusted to its care, allocating them prudently for the betterment of communities in our region.

Interesting data from their 2020 990 filing

The filing documents outline the non-profit's mission as “The community foundation for northeast georgia, inc. was founded to improve the quality of community life through increased philanthropy. the foundation is a public charity formed to benefit the citizens of northeast georgia through the development of endowment funds. the foundation receives charitable contributions that are then invested with the income disbursed to nonprofit organizations serving in the areas of health, human services, education, community service and the arts.”.

When outlining the tasks it performs, they were referred to as: “The foundation has three principal goals:1) to build a permanent base of charitable funds that will benefit nonprofit agencies serving the northeast georgia region;2) to identify essential human needs and promising opportunities in the community especially as they impact the less fortunate and to develop resources to address them; and3) to acquaint donors with the importance of private philanthropy as it relates to improving the quality of life of the community.”.

  • The non-profit's reported state of operation is GA as per legal requirements.
  • The filing reveals that the address of the non-profit in 2020 is 6500 SUGARLOAF PKWY NO 220, DULUTH, GA, 30097.
  • As of 2020, the non-profit has 4 employees reported on their 990 form.
  • Is not a private foundation.
  • Expenses are greater than $1,000,000.
  • Revenue is greater than $1,000,000.
  • Revenue less expenses is $3,277,868.
  • The organization has 24 independent voting members.
  • The organization was formed in 1985.
  • The organization pays $242,469 in salary, compensation, and benefits to its employees.
  • The organization pays $298,327 in fundraising expenses.
